Raipur: The city is set to host CRITICON 2025, a premier national conference on Critical Care Medicine, bringing together the brightest minds from across the globe. This two-day academic event, themed “Where Critical Care Meets Clinical Excellence,” is being organized by Ramkrishna CARE Hospital, Raipur, in association with the Indian Society of Critical Care Medicine (ISCCM) and Quality Care India Ltd And IMA Raipur.
The conclave will include leading intensivists, anesthesiologists, pulmonologists, trauma and emergency specialists, and healthcare innovators from major institutions nationwide to deliberate on the latest developments in intensive care. The event will serve as a multidisciplinary platform for experts to exchange ideas, share experiences, and explore solutions to the evolving challenges in critical care delivery.
Adding an international dimension to the event, two distinguished global experts will be joining the conclave — Dr. Marcus J. Schultz from the Netherlands, Full Professor ,Intensive Care Medicine and All-Immunology Affiliatie UvA, specializing in ACS- Diabetes and Hypertensive Diseases,ACS Microcirculation, and ACS Pulmonary Hypertension and Critical Care; and Dr. Quirino Piacevoli, Professor and Head, Department of Anesthesia and Intensive Care, San Filippo Neri Hospital, Rome, Italy.
In addition, renowned doctors and critical care specialists from Mumbai, Chennai, Gurugram, Secunderabad, Varanasi, Ahmedabad, New Delhi, Nagpur, Pune, Raipur, Hyderabad, Bhubaneswar, Ranchi, and Bangalore will be participating in the event. Nearly 1,000 delegates are expected to attend from across Chhattisgarh, Madhya Pradesh, Odisha, and Maharashtra, making CRITICON 2025 one of the most significant gatherings of critical care professionals in Central India.
A Scientific Confluence of Innovation and Collaboration
The scientific program of CRITICON Raipur 2025 has been carefully curated to blend evidence-based learning with practical application.
Sessions will focus on a diverse range of high-impact topics, including:
- Advances in sepsis and shock management
- Mechanical ventilation and oxygenation strategies
- Neurocritical care and post-operative critical care
- Hemodynamic monitoring and bedside ultrasound
- Ethics, end-of-life decisions, and quality in ICU practice
Renowned faculty members from across India will share their expertise through keynote lectures, panel discussions, and workshops.
Hands-on training modules will allow participants to gain experience in advanced airway management, POCUS (Point-of-Care Ultrasound), and ICU procedural skills.
Day-Wise Highlights:
Day 1 — 25 October 2025:
- Inaugural ceremony and keynote address by distinguished national faculty
- Scientific sessions on Sepsis, ARDS, and Shock Management
- Expert panel: “Bridging Research and Real-World ICU Practice”
- Interactive case discussions and clinical debates
Day 2 — 26 October 2025:
- Skill workshops on mechanical ventilation and ultrasound-guided interventions
- Parallel sessions on Neurocritical and Trauma Care
- Interactive discussion: “The Future of Artificial Intelligence and Tele-ICU Models”
- Valedictory session and concluding remarks
The event is CGMC credit-points approved, enabling attending clinicians to earn continuing medical education credits.
